“Lovely, but needs to be freshened up!”

We stayed here 2 nights and noticed a few things. While the hotel is amazing and the property could not be nicer the hotel could use some painting, some areas are really just looking not so fresh.

Our room was lovely but the floor was not clean when we checked in. We called housekeeping and they came immediately. That was great.

The hotel staff was wonderful, we spoke with a lovely woman in one of the shops who gave us some great advice on the local food. Also one of the concerige, was lovely too.

“"high expectations, low satisfaction"”

I booked "amex magic nights" fourth night free, 2 daily breakfast for 3 days and two one day water park passes requested two queen beds but was assigned two full size beds. It was that or a king size bed and an air bed for my teenage daughter, for the price I considered it unfair. After considering to cancel the reservation they offered a transfer to Las Casitas Villas, very nice rooms and ocean views but very uncomfortable full size beds, my back still hurts. The first morning I had to stand in line for more than 25 minutes to be seated for breakfast ,it was very disorganized. They overbooked rooms and we received a poor service. At the concierge desk, for one question I was given 3 different answers and none of them where certain. I was misinformed by phone. About the water park, it is small, stairs to get to the slides stink like urine. They gave me a bottle of wine and apologized, that did not make it better. Y do not think I would go again and I can not recommend it. I hope you have a better experience.

“Liked the El Conquistador”

we just retured from a family vacation at the El Conquistador.in Puerto Rico. While we had some initial difficulty with the room we requested, the staff more than made up for it by immediately switching us to a more appropriate room. I have to say that the hotelseemed a little run down in places, but overall it was a beautiful setting and the staff could not have been nicer and accomodating to our every need. The one thing that was tough was evening activities, especially with kids in the 12-17 years range. Outside of dinner, there is not a lot to do for them. The water parks closed early, but it was really fun. The beach was phenomena, but again, it closed early. The restaurants were very overpriced for the quality of the food, although ballyhoo's seemed to be the best deal.. All in all, we had a great time

“Great Vacations”

I just visited this hotel with my family. We stayed at Las Casitas Village for 7 nights. The villa’s view was spectacular and was very clean. We called guest service a couple of times and were quickly assisted. We never had any problems with towels or linen, they were very attentive with our needs. Lilliam in las Casitas Reception was always very useful, as well as all bell staff and the waiters from Infinity pool. We went to Coqui Waterpark but it was raining so much, we could enjoy it very much. Also, went to Palomino which is beautiful, yet the drinks at the beach are watery (not good at all). But overall, it was a nice vacation, I hope to come next year as well.

“Great vacation”

We recently returned from a wonderful tip to the El Conquistador. Our room, view, private island -- all were wonderful. We had stayed here when it was a Wyndham 4 years ago and it appears that the new owners have done some renovations. The only part I didn't like was that our bathroom (which was huge) had a sliding, non-locking door which is not good if you have little kids. We opted for the Water Park package, which was a fabulous deal. My only complaint was the prices of the food. You're pretty much stuck on the resort unless you have a rental car and the owners definitely gouge the food prices. Otherwise, we had a wonderful 5 day stay and would definitely return.
